ISLAMIC RELIEF

 

Established in 1984 in the UK, Islamic Relief is an international NGO seeking to promote sustainable economic and social development by working with local communities through relief and development programmes. We aim to help the needy regardless of race, religion or gender.

 

The main sectors we are involved in are: Education and Vocational Training, Health and Nutrition, Water and Sanitation, Income Generation, Emergency Relief, Disaster Preparedness, and Orphans Support.

 

Our core geographical areas of operation are : Albania, Bosnia & Hercegovina, Kosova (Central Europe), Azerbaijan and Chechnya (Central Asia), Afghanistan, Bangladesh, India and Pakistan (Western and South Asia), Gaza Strip (Palestinian Autonomous Area), Mali and Sudan (Africa) and the Middle East.

 

The majority of our funding is from private donations however we also receive support from institutions such as DFID, WFP and UNHCR.

 

Islamic Relief is an NGO in consultative status (category special) with the Economic and Social Council of the United Nations. We are also members of British Overseas NGOs for Development (BOND) and UK Platform of the Liaison Committee of Development NGOs to the European Union and signatories to the Code of Conduct for The International Red Cross and Red Crescent Movement and NGOs in Disaster Relief.

Deloitte Emerging Markets is the specialized development consulting arm of Deloitte Touche Tohmatsu. Deloitte Emerging Markets manages the firm's services to international donor agencies and emerging economies, coordinating resources from our national practices. Deloitte includes specialized sectoral and industry units in health, utilities and infrastructure, the financial sector, agribusiness, public sector reform, and private sector development.

 

The Commercial Market Strategies (CMS) Project is funded by the U.S. Agency for International Development (USAID) to work with the private and commercial sectors in developing countries to increase the use of high quality family planning products and services and thereby achieve improved health and manageable growth for those countries' populations. It is composed of a consortium of organizations with expertise in taking on this mission: Deloitte and Touche, Population Services International (PSI), Abt Associates, and Meridian Group International.

 

CMS Philippines Project: USAID/Philippines has recently requested CMS' assistance to expand the commercial sector's role in helping meet current and future demand for affordable, quality family planning products and services. To do this, CMS will work extensively with a variety of private/commercial groups including pharmaceutical companies, pharmaceutical distributors and retailers, private medical providers and their professional associations, and health insurance providers and associations. CMS will also work with select government departments and representatives.
